Photovoltaic array simulation

1985 IEEE Power Electronics Specialists Conference (ESA SP-230), 1985
Two approaches to the simulation of photovoltaic arrays are described and compared. The first involves the use of a pilot panel and variable light source. In the second, characteristic array curves are stored in the memory of a microprocessor-based simulator.

Simulation of large photovoltaic arrays

Solar Energy, 2018
Abstract Large photovoltaic arrays are becoming common as the world moves to replace fossil-fuelled electricity generators. As the array size and project cost increase, it becomes increasingly important to know accurately what the array’s performance will be before it is built.
